学编程用什么软件练手
-
学编程用来练习的软件有很多种,以下是几个比较常用和适合初学者的编程软件。
-
Scratch:Scratch是一款非常适合初学者入门的编程软件。它使用拖拽式的编程方式,不需要编写繁琐的代码,而是通过拼接代码块来完成程序。它有一个友好的可视化界面,可以帮助新手快速理解基本编程概念。
-
Python IDLE:Python IDLE是Python官方提供的集成开发环境(IDE),适合学习Python语言的初学者使用。它提供了一个交互式的命令行界面和一个代码编辑器,能够在同一个环境中编写和运行Python代码。
-
Visual Studio Code:Visual Studio Code是一款功能强大的编程编辑器,支持多种编程语言。它提供了丰富的扩展插件,可以适应不同学习需求。对于初学者来说,可安装一些相关插件和扩展,如Python扩展来学习Python编程。
-
Codecademy:Codecademy是一家在线学习平台,提供各种编程语言的教程。它可以作为一个练习平台,通过在线编写和运行代码来学习和巩固编程知识。在Codecademy上,你可以找到适合自己的编程课程,并进行实时编码练习。
-
LeetCode:LeetCode是一个面向程序员的在线编程练习平台,主要用于准备技术面试。它提供了大量的编程题目,包括算法、数据结构等,可以帮助你提升编码能力和解决问题的能力。
以上是几个适合初学者用来练手的编程软件,选择适合自己的软件进行练习,能够帮助你快速入门和提升编程能力。记住,多动手实践是学习编程的最佳方法!
1年前 -
-
学习编程可以使用多种软件来练手,下面是几个常用的编程软件:
-
Python:Python是一种简单易学的编程语言,它具有简洁的语法和强大的功能。Python的官方解释器以及集成开发环境(IDE)如PyCharm和Anaconda可以帮助你编写、调试和运行Python程序。
-
Java:Java是一种面向对象的编程语言,被广泛应用于开发应用程序、移动应用和企业级应用。Java的开发环境包括Java Development Kit(JDK)和集成开发环境(IDE)如Eclipse和IntelliJ IDEA。
-
C++:C++是一种通用的编程语言,广泛应用于系统开发、嵌入式系统和游戏开发。C++的开发环境有多种选择,如Microsoft Visual Studio、Code::Blocks和CLion等。
-
HTML/CSS/JavaScript:HTML、CSS和JavaScript是构建网页和网页应用的基本技术。你可以使用任何文本编辑器编写HTML和CSS代码,然后使用浏览器将其运行。同时,你也可以使用类似Sublime Text、Visual Studio Code等专业的文本编辑器来提高开发效率。
-
Scratch:Scratch是一种图形化编程语言,主要面向初学者和孩子们。它通过拖拽代码块的方式让编程更加可视化和易于理解,适合编程新手入门。
此外,还有许多其他编程软件可供选择,如Ruby、C#、Swift等,你可以根据自己的兴趣和学习目标选择适合自己的编程软件进行练手。无论选择哪种软件,重要的是要按照一个具体的项目或问题学习和练习,这样可以更好地理解和应用所学知识。
1年前 -
-
学编程时,有很多软件可以供我们练手。不同的编程语言和目标会有不同的软件选择。下面我将针对不同的编程语言和目标,介绍一些常用的练手软件。
一、编程语言为Python的软件练手
-
Jupyter Notebook
Jupyter Notebook是一款非常流行的交互式编程环境,适合用于学习和快速试验Python代码。它可以逐个单元格运行代码,并且支持Markdown文本。可以在Jupyter Notebook中编写python代码、运行并查看结果。 -
PyCharm
PyCharm是一款专业的Python集成开发环境(IDE),提供了丰富的功能,包括代码提示、代码自动补全、调试等。它支持多种编程语言,而且很容易上手。 -
Visual Studio Code
Visual Studio Code是一款非常流行的轻量级代码编辑器,它支持多种编程语言,并且拥有丰富的插件生态系统,可以根据需要添加对Python的支持插件。Visual Studio Code具有强大的代码编辑、调试和版本控制等功能。
二、编程语言为Java的软件练手
-
Eclipse
Eclipse是一款免费且功能强大的Java集成开发环境(IDE),它支持Java以及其他几十种编程语言。Eclipse具有代码自动补全、错误检查、调试等功能,还支持插件扩展,可以通过安装插件来增加其他功能的支持。 -
IntelliJ IDEA
IntelliJ IDEA是一款商业的Java集成开发环境(IDE),它专注于提供高效的Java开发环境。IntelliJ IDEA具有强大的代码编辑、重构、调试和版本控制等功能,适合用于开发Java应用程序。
三、编程语言为C/C++的软件练手
-
Code::Blocks
Code::Blocks是一款免费且跨平台的C/C++集成开发环境(IDE),它支持多种编译器,包括GCC和Clang等。Code::Blocks具有代码自动补全、调试、编译器配置等功能,是学习和练习C/C++的良好选择。 -
Visual Studio
Visual Studio是一款强大的集成开发环境,支持多种编程语言,包括C、C++和C#等。它具有丰富的功能,包括代码编辑、调试、性能分析和版本控制等,适合用于开发和练习C/C++程序。
四、编程语言为Web前端开发的软件练手
-
Sublime Text
Sublime Text是一款轻量级的代码编辑器,支持多种编程语言,包括HTML、CSS和JavaScript等。它具有强大的代码编辑功能,支持代码高亮、代码折叠、代码片段等特性。 -
Visual Studio Code
Visual Studio Code在Web开发方面也非常流行。它支持HTML、CSS、JavaScript等多种编程语言,并且具有丰富的插件生态系统,可以根据需求添加相关插件,提供更好的开发体验。
以上是一些常用的软件练手选择,根据自己学习的编程语言和目标,选择一个合适的编程软件进行练习,可以更好地提高编程技能。
1年前 -